Sulianet Ortiz: Lyon, France
 

While studying abroad over the summer with the Regent’s program in Lyon, France I was able to see a lot of France. Although I spent most of my time in Lyon, I visited the biggest cathedral in the world in Amiens, saw the Mediterranean Sea while in Cassis and Nice in the south, went to the biggest theater festival in Avignon, and visited Paris. After the program was over I visited Barcelona, Florence, Venice, and Pisa.
